About Swayable

Swayable is a fast-growing cloud data product that doubles the impact of advertising by empirically measuring how it changes people's opinions. Our customers include Amazon, Paramount Pictures, MIT, Stanford, the Biden-Harris presidential campaign, and multiple state authorities fighting COVID. We were founded in 2018 by two physics PhDs and are backed by leading technology and social impact investors, including Y Combinator. This position is the perfect opportunity to join a fast-moving, high-impact, mission-oriented startup.

Technology Stack

Swayable uses MongoDB, Python (Numpy, Scipy, Pandas, Celery, Flask), Javascript (Node.js, Express.js, Vue.js), and GraphQL.

About the Role

Swayable is seeking a Staff Engineer with deep expertise in AI, ML, and scientific computing to advance the state of the art analytics engine that powers our core product. In this role, you will be the architect and technical lead for a team that productizes all AI, machine learning, and data analysis at Swayable. You will be responsible for building, maintaining, and continuously improving our tools, techniques, and architecture for high-performance computing. You will mentor a talented and diverse team of engineers and data scientists. You will also work closely with a cross-functional team to build new features and solve novel problems across the spectrum of software engineering, data visualization, and science.

The Staff Engineer will report to our CTO, Valerie Coffman.
